Understanding Collaborative Learning

Before diving into best practices, it’s essential to understand what collaborative learning entails. At its core, collaborative learning is an educational approach that involves groups of students working together towards a common goal. This method encourages participants to share ideas, challenge each other’s thoughts, and build knowledge collaboratively.

The benefits of collaborative learning include:

  • Enhanced Critical Thinking: Engaging in discussions allows students to analyze different perspectives.
  • Improved Communication Skills: Students learn how to articulate their thoughts clearly and listen actively.
  • Greater Engagement: Collaborative tasks are often more engaging than traditional, individual assignments.
  • Development of Interpersonal Skills: Working in groups helps students develop teamwork and conflict-resolution skills.

5. Establish Roles and Responsibilities

Assigning specific roles within each group can help streamline collaboration by providing clarity on individual responsibilities. Roles could include:

  • Facilitator: Leads discussions and ensures everyone participates.
  • Note-taker: Records key points from meetings or discussions.
  • Presenter: Prepares the final presentation or report.

By defining roles on Academic Guna, groups can function more effectively, ensuring that tasks are completed efficiently.

9. Assess Collaboratively

Assessment in collaborative learning environments requires a nuanced approach because traditional grading methods might not accurately reflect individual contributions:

  • Implement peer evaluations where students assess each other’s participation and effort.
  • Create rubrics that assess both group outcomes and individual performance based on specified criteria.

Utilizing these assessment strategies within Academic Guna ensures that evaluations are fair and reflective of collaborative efforts.
